I think what you mean is *some* southerners who don't get out much think UK graffiti is London, Bristol and Brighton. The rest of us think Nottingham/Lesta, Newcastle/North East, Glasgow, Liverpool, Cardif, Edinbroo, London, Bristol etc etc. Almost every town has a scene and a history back to the old days - just cos it's not in Graphotism or on 12oz doesn't mean anything.

 

As for what foreigners think and what we think of other countries - its just as much to do with geographical ignorance on all our parts. I mean, I admit I don't really know any French cities apart from Paris...

 

Look a bit harder, there's kings everywhere...except Chelmsford.
